|
|
Другие темы раздела | |
C++ WinAPI Ошибка в dll при обращении к потоку вывода cout
https://www.cyberforum.ru/ win-api/ thread1834683.html друзья программисты, подскажите пожалуйста, как решить проблему с dll. Выдаёт ошибку в функции реализованной в DLL, которая подключается явно. Вот код содержащийся в dll, def файл тоже есть, она подключается и функции эти находит, но Print вылетает как только пытается вывести *p на консоль using namespace std; extern "C" __declspec(dllexport) void __stdcall Print(char* p){ cout <<... |
Ошибка записи в буфер C++ WinAPI Добрый день! Помогите, пожалуйста. PID - идентификатор процесса. Сначала сохраняю модуль в szBuffer, а затем вывожу в ComBoBox. Проблема состоит в следующем: В данной строке название модуля записывается в буфер. Но почему то, вместо названия модуля, в буфер записываются непонятные символы и различные иероглифы. Подскажите, в чем проблема? StringCchPrintf(szBuffer, _countof(szBuffer),... |
C++ WinAPI GetKeyboardLayout всегда выдает один язык
https://www.cyberforum.ru/ win-api/ thread1834091.html скажу сразу что подобную тему уже видел, но ясного ответа там не увидел. Делаю так GetWindowThreadProcessId(GetForegroundWindow(), (LPDWORD)&dwPID); HKL lange = GetKeyboardLayout(dwPID); но раскладку всегда одну и туже показывает, хотя по факту она разная |
C++ WinAPI DLL для просмотра дампа памяти
https://www.cyberforum.ru/ win-api/ thread1833893.html Необходимо реализовать DLL для просмотра дампа памяти. Подскажите как это можно реализовать или, может, у кого-нибудь есть наработки по данной теме. заранее спасибо. |
C++ WinAPI Странная работа FindFirstFile Здравствуйте! Вывожу функциями FindFirstFile и FindNextFile и получаю имена "." и ".." далее идут все файлы находящиеся в указанной директории. Не подскажете почему получаются имена с точками? |
C++ WinAPI Вывод текста в окно помогите пожалуйста как сделать вывод текста в окно с помощью WM_PAINT вот этого кода: int main() { setlocale(LC_ALL, "Russian"); // определение кофигурации ПК TCHAR LogicalDrives; DWORD dwResult = GetLogicalDriveStrings(256, LogicalDrives); if (dwResult > 0 && dwResult <= 256) https://www.cyberforum.ru/ win-api/ thread1833782.html |
C++ WinAPI Эффект бегущей строки в заголовке приложения
https://www.cyberforum.ru/ win-api/ thread1833575.html вот код, помогите с частью где строка должна бегать не могу правильно написать код //3. реализовать эффект бегущей строки в заголовке приложения. применить кольцевую очередь. #include <windows.h> #define _CRT_SECURE_NO_WARNINGS #include <ctime> #include <string> |
Нарисовать рекурсивный рисунок C++ WinAPI Здравствуйте! Мне поставлена задача нарисовать рекурсивный рисунок (кружочки) в Visual Studio 2010. Вот картинка требуемая и код но у меня получается вот так: по логике надо сделать либо, чтобы окружности были прозрачными, либо чтобы чтобы рисование начиналось "снаружи", с маленьких окружностей, но я не знаю как это сделать! // laba4.cpp: определяет точку входа для приложения. // |
C++ WinAPI Получение числа, записанного в строке
https://www.cyberforum.ru/ win-api/ thread1833413.html Добрый день! Помогите, пожалуйста. В TCHAR szBuffer = TEXT(""); записана строка вида: "Название___123" После надписи идет три пробела. Мне необходимо оставить только число 123 и перевести его в int Помогите, пожалуйста! Начала вот так, но дальше не знаю. for (int i = 0; i < _countof(szBuffer); i++) |
C++ WinAPI Запуск приложения через WinExec
https://www.cyberforum.ru/ win-api/ thread1833325.html Ребята помогите пожалуйста запустить приложение, используя WinExec WinExec("1.exe", SW_SHOW); В папку с файлом .cpp положил exe файл, но он почему-то не запускает. Пытался по пути запускать тоже 0 реакции. |
C++ WinAPI Получить текст из элемента ListBox Добрый день! Помогите, пожалуйста. Получаю индекс выбранной записи из ListBox number = SendMessage(hListBoxProc, LB_GETCURSEL, 0, wParam); Теперь мне нужно по данному индексу получить текст элемента Listbox Помогите, пожалуйста! |
C++ WinAPI Элемент treeView функция GetItem при нажатии
https://www.cyberforum.ru/ win-api/ thread1832953.html Здравствуйте! Нашел такой способ: case WM_NOTIFY: { if (((LPNMHDR)lParam)->code == NM_CLICK) { char Text = ""; memset(&tvi, 0, sizeof(tvi)); Selected = (HTREEITEM)SendMessage(treeView, TVM_GETNEXTITEM, TVGN_CARET, (LPARAM)Selected); |
19 / 16 / 10
Регистрация: 07.11.2015
Сообщений: 136
|
||||||
26.10.2016, 22:49 [ТС] | 0 | |||||
Однострочный редактор текста Edit не редактирует текст. И несколько вопр-сов от начинающего по CreateWindowEx - C++ WinAPI - Ответ 969300126.10.2016, 22:49. Показов 2035. Ответов 8
Метки (Все метки)
Ответ
Alex5, Вот блин. А чего я не написал TranslateMessage(&msg); ...
Спасибо, сам бы я никогда этого не заметил бы. Теперь редактор редактирует)) Добавлено через 23 минуты Я понимаю, что должна получать функция CreateWindowEx. Второй и третий параметр -это "длинный" указатель на строковую константу. Те, вот когда я создавал окно, я объявлял переменную, присваивал ей какую-либо строку, а функции передавал уже переменную. А тут функцией CreateWindowEx создается контрол, и в учебнике написано
Если это не критично, то пускай останется так. Но хотелось бы заполнить этот пробел и понимать. Вернуться к обсуждению: Однострочный редактор текста Edit не редактирует текст. И несколько вопр-сов от начинающего по CreateWindowEx C++ WinAPI
0
|
26.10.2016, 22:49 | |
Готовые ответы и решения:
8
Создать однострочный редактор текста (строку с вводом символов) и кнопку Однострочный редактор Однострочный пакетный редактор на си Однострочный и многострочный редактор |
26.10.2016, 22:49 | |
26.10.2016, 22:49 | |
Помогаю со студенческими работами здесь
0
Удаленный однострочный редактор Однострочный редактор и кодировка Несколько вопр. о DLL Не редактирует текст буквами Добавление в Memo текста из Edit + еще определенный текст Составить 4 вида вопр-ых предложений к тексту (2 вопр-ых предложения для каждого вида) |